The book, A <strong>color</strong> <strong>atlas</strong> <strong>of</strong> <strong>meteorites</strong> <strong>in</strong> th<strong>in</strong> <strong>section</strong> by<br />
Dante S. Lauretta and Marv<strong>in</strong> Killgore, is a compilation <strong>of</strong><br />
classic examples <strong>of</strong> beautiful photomicrographs <strong>of</strong> almost<br />
every meteorite class and type and accompanied by short<br />
descriptions <strong>of</strong> each class and type. I suspect that when you<br />
first read through this book you will have the same reaction as<br />
we did: you will not be able to put it down. If it is not already<br />
apparent, the book is outstand<strong>in</strong>g, with respect to both the<br />
publish<strong>in</strong>g and the quality <strong>of</strong> its contents.<br />
The book starts with a succ<strong>in</strong>ct general <strong>in</strong>troduction to<br />
the subject <strong>of</strong> meteorite classification. This <strong>section</strong> is<br />
Book Review<br />
followed by a two-page <strong>in</strong>troduction to ord<strong>in</strong>ary chondrites<br />
with some 134 pages <strong>of</strong> micrographs <strong>of</strong> different ord<strong>in</strong>ary<br />
chondrites. The authors stick to a brief, two-page <strong>in</strong>troduction<br />
to each meteorite class and type, which works perfectly for<br />
the purpose <strong>of</strong> this <strong>atlas</strong>. After ord<strong>in</strong>ary chondrites, the<br />
authors discuss separately enstatite chondrites, carbonaceous<br />
chondrites, and f<strong>in</strong>ally, other chondrites. At page 206, the<br />
authors leave their completed representation <strong>of</strong> chondrites<br />
and give separate attention to primitive achondrites and<br />
f<strong>in</strong>ally evolved achondrites (<strong>in</strong>clud<strong>in</strong>g SNCs and lunar).<br />
S<strong>in</strong>ce this is an <strong>atlas</strong> <strong>of</strong> <strong>meteorites</strong> <strong>in</strong> th<strong>in</strong> <strong>section</strong>, it rightly<br />
does not <strong>in</strong>clude iron or stony-iron <strong>meteorites</strong>. Throughout<br />
the book, pla<strong>in</strong> and crossed-polarized light images are shown<br />
for what are or certa<strong>in</strong>ly could be considered type specimens<br />
<strong>of</strong> <strong>meteorites</strong> from each class and type. In specific cases,<br />
reflect light and backscatter electron images are also shown.<br />
The book is a perfect supplement to a course on <strong>meteorites</strong> or<br />
939 © The Meteoritical Society, 2005. Pr<strong>in</strong>ted <strong>in</strong> USA.
940 Book Review<br />
planetary materials, or as a reference book when exam<strong>in</strong><strong>in</strong>g<br />
samples <strong>in</strong> th<strong>in</strong> <strong>section</strong>, either optically or through backscatter<br />
electrons.<br />
